☆ Be the first to review + Add to your collection — Join freeJonah Hex looks thoroughly worse for wear on this April 1986 cover, rendered with raw energy by Denys Cowan and Dick Giordano — the scarred gunfighter is mid-brawl, revolver in one bandaged hand and a flaming weapon in the other, while a second battered figure tumbles beneath him in a tangle of fists and firearms. It's a frenetic, kinetic image that sets the tone perfectly for the story inside, "The Shooting Gallery," written by Fleisher with interior art by Ron Wagner and Carlos Garzón. Hex's sci-fi future setting gets a shot of wild, rough-and-tumble energy here that fans of the series will find hard to resist.
